- Shib CAMP
June 2008, Ann Arbor MI
Planning is well under way for this Shib 2.0 installfest, and there is discussion about including a "train the trainer" component. Given the high interest in this aspect there will be a different registration process to ensure geographic diversity among other criteria to ensure the broadest possible impact.

Since Shib v2.0 will fully interoperate with Shib v1.3, IdPs can upgrade and interoperate with SPs running 1.3.

- RADIUS/SAML
Eduroam is looking at SAML for AuthZ and federated NAC (TNC). Josh has been working with the TNC working group on this, and there is interest in pursuing this among that community.
https://www.trustedcomputinggroup.org/groups/network/

SAML schema which would allow organizations to assert device posture info, i.e. assertions of attributes of hardware in addition to attributes of users. There was some discussion about whether it would make sense to develop an object class for this purpose, e.g. "eduDevice" or "eduHost."

The TNC work will likely ultimately be standardized through the IETF NEA WG.
